Tasting Notes
Colour
In the glass a cherry red color with rusty red reflections of medium depth.
Nose
Good aromatic intensity, with balsamic notes and ripe fruit on the nose.
Palate
Soft and clean on the palate with a fresh and elegant taste and well-integrated tannins on the finish.
Producer
Positioned in La Rioja, the winery Bodega Eduardo Garrido Garcia offers wine enjoyment in the middle of Spain, close to the coastal region of the Atlantic Ocean. Although the town is separated from the sea by almost 40 kilometers of natural parks and mountains, cold Atlantic winds find their way to the cultivated areas and provide the necessary cooling, especially on hot summer days. Since 1923, visitors to this winery have been able to discover a surprising selection of exquisite red and white wines.
His grandfather already ensured excellent results with his passion for the taste of delicious wines. Today it is Amelia Garrido who runs the winery together with her father and protects the high quality of the products with the same care. After sustainable production, the individual bottles are transported directly to the winery's customers. This not only protects the environment, but also offers those interested personalized access to a unique taste experience.
It is important for Amelia Garrido to preserve the surrounding nature and focus on selected varieties. Strong aromas and a purple color give the winery's Vino Joven a special character that the winery wants to maintain in any case. Young, mature wines with fruity notes form the foundation of Bodega Eduardo Garrido Garcia. At least up to 20% of these wines have also been aged in barrels for three months.
At Bodega Eduardo Garrido Garcia, connoisseurs encounter wines that grow 600 meters above sea level. The vines grown there produce strong red wines and draw their support from the existing clay soils, which are also rich in calcium. Nevertheless, the Bodega Eduardo Garrido Garcia winery also takes advantage of the region's prevailing microclimate, which always guarantees sufficient sun and cool temperatures at the same time.
